php使用什么服务器

不及物动词 其他 29

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在使用PHP时,可以选择多种服务器来托管和运行PHP代码。以下是一些常见的PHP服务器:

    1. Apache服务器:Apache是最常用的PHP服务器之一,它稳定、可靠,并支持多种操作系统,如Windows、Linux和Mac。Apache通过使用模块来处理PHP代码,可以很容易地与PHP集成。

    2. Nginx服务器:Nginx是另一个流行的HTTP服务器,它也可以用于托管PHP应用程序。与Apache相比,Nginx是一个轻量级的服务器,并且在处理高并发请求时表现出色。

    3. Microsoft IIS服务器:Microsoft Internet Information Services(IIS)是Windows操作系统的默认Web服务器,它也支持PHP。通过安装PHP扩展以及配置IIS,您可以在Windows服务器上轻松地运行PHP网站。

    4. LiteSpeed服务器:LiteSpeed是一个高性能的Web服务器,可以与PHP一起使用。它具有快速的处理速度和低资源消耗,适用于高负载的网站。

    这些服务器都有各自的特点和优势,具体选择取决于您的需求和环境。在选择服务器时,可以考虑以下方面:

    • 性能要求:如果需要处理高并发请求或者性能要求较高,可以选择Nginx或LiteSpeed等高性能服务器。
    • 操作系统:不同的服务器支持不同的操作系统。如果您的服务器运行在Windows上,可以考虑使用IIS,如果是Linux或者Mac,可以选择Apache或者Nginx。
    • 配置和集成:不同的服务器对于PHP的集成和配置方式可能会有所不同。您可以根据具体情况选择简单易用或者更灵活的服务器。

    总结来说,选择哪个服务器都取决于您的需求和个人偏好。以上是几个常见的PHP服务器,您可以根据自己的情况选择合适的服务器来托管和运行PHP应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PHP可以在多个类型的服务器上运行。以下是几个常见的PHP服务器:

    1. Apache服务器:Apache是最常用的PHP服务器之一,它是开源的,可在Windows、Linux和其他操作系统上运行。Apache具有强大的功能和灵活性,并且可以与PHP无缝集成。

    2. Nginx服务器:Nginx也是一个流行的PHP服务器选择,尤其在高并发环境下表现良好。它是一个轻量级的服务器,可以处理大量的同时连接请求。与Apache相比,Nginx的配置更简单,并且可以通过一些优化技巧提高性能。

    3. IIS服务器:Internet Information Services(IIS)是运行在Windows服务器上的Microsoft的Web服务器。它内置了对PHP的支持,并且与Windows操作系统紧密集成。 IIS与PHP的集成需要一些额外的配置,但是这可以通过使用FastCGI模块来实现。

    4. Lighttpd服务器:Lighttpd是另一款轻量级的Web服务器,也可以用于运行PHP。它被设计用于高性能和低资源消耗,并且可以与PHP无缝集成。

    5. PHP内置服务器:从PHP版本5.4开始,PHP引入了一个内置的开发服务器用于开发和测试目的。这个服务器非常简单,仅供本地使用,不适用于生产环境。 它不如其他服务器那样强大,但是对于简单的开发任务是足够的。

    无论选择哪个PHP服务器,都需要配置服务器以与PHP解释器进行交互。这通常涉及安装和配置适当的Web服务器模块、设置PHP配置文件和对服务器进行必要的调整。 选择服务器的最佳方法是根据项目的需求和你对服务器的了解来决定。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    PHP 可以运行在多种服务器环境上,包括但不限于以下几种:

    1. Apache HTTP 服务器:Apache 是最流行的 Web 服务器之一,它支持 PHP 的模块方式运行。在 Apache 服务器中,可以使用 mod_php 模块或者 PHP-FPM 进程管理器来运行 PHP 代码。

    2. Nginx:Nginx 是另一种常用的 Web 服务器,它也可以与 PHP 搭配使用。与 Apache 不同,Nginx 使用 PHP-FPM 进程管理器来处理 PHP 请求。

    3. LiteSpeed:LiteSpeed 是一个高性能的服务器软件,它可以兼容 Apache 的配置文件,并且支持 PHP-FPM。LiteSpeed 比 Apache 在高并发请求条件下具有更好的性能表现。

    4. Microsoft IIS:Microsoft IIS 是为 Windows 系统提供的 Web 服务器软件,它可以通过 FastCGI 来处理 PHP 请求。

    5. Caddy:Caddy 是一个现代化的 Web 服务器,它支持自动化的 HTTPS 配置,并且可以与 PHP-FPM 或者 FastCGI 搭配使用来运行 PHP。

    6. 其他 Web 服务器:还有一些其他的 Web 服务器可以与 PHP 搭配使用,例如 Lighttpd、Cherokee 等。

    在选择服务器环境时,需要考虑以下几个因素:

    • 性能:选择一个性能良好的服务器可以提高 PHP 应用程序的响应速度。
    • 配置:服务器环境的配置要与 PHP 版本兼容,并且能够满足应用程序的需求。
    • 安全性:选择一个具备良好安全性的服务器可以提供更好的安全保障。
    • 可扩展性:根据应用程序的需求,选择一个能够方便扩展的服务器环境。
    • 简便性:选择一个易于配置和操作的服务器环境可以提高开发和维护效率。

    无论选择哪种服务器环境,都需要确保服务器上已经安装了 PHP 解释器,并且配置了适当的 PHP 扩展和相关的设置。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部